Transcriptomics analyses and biochemical characterization of Aspergillus flavus spores exposed to 1-nonanol.

Published in 2022 at "Applied microbiology and biotechnology"

DOI: 10.1007/s00253-022-11830-4

Abstract: The exploitation of plant volatile organic compounds as biofumigants to control postharvest decaying of agro-products has received considerable research attention.
